By-the-Minute Good for Small Talkers

Overall Rating:
3.7 out of 5
By: James Marshall on Wednesday, October 04, 2006
From: College Park, MD (United States)
Experience: 9 Months
Pros: Availability of a by-the-minute plan allows greater control over costs; generally good coverage in my experience; monthly plans also available

Cons: Cost per minute is typically higher than with a more standard monthly plan; pre-paid; must add $20 to your account every 3 months even if you have money in it already

Summary: I chose Virgin Mobile based on my parents' recommendation. I wanted a cell phone primarily for emergency use and didn't want to be locked into a monthly plan, which would cost a lot more than the time I intended to use. My parents wanted the same thing, so they looked around and decided on Virgin Mobile's by-the-minute option. I also joined with the same option, and it's been a good service for all of us.

The drawback is having to add money to your account every 3 months even though you have money in it. But that's how they keep your service active, and it's only $20 at a time, so it can cost as little as $80 a year to have a cell phone (the phone itself is extra, of course). For small talkers, I think monthly plans would have a hard time matching this.

Okay service, but there are better alternatives

Overall Rating:
2 out of 5
By: Jonathan Pusar on Tuesday, September 12, 2006
From: Brooklyn, NY (United States)
Experience: 4 Years
Pros: Relativally cheap phones
Decent Pricing plan
Bonus minutes every once in awhile

Cons: There are better values for prepaid over the years
Service is spotty in NYC
Having to pay 10 cents a day just to brose their store.

Summary: I'll cut to the chase: Years ago when I got the VM, the pricing was excelent, and it was the only phone service that allowed you 3 months to top it up without spending $60+ a shot.

Now, TMobile and Co. has stepped uo their game by offering 1yr to top up after reaching a certain statice, and still no Weekend specials. Plus spotty service, etc. Just not worth it.

The only reason I still have it is because my phone is not broken.
